The installation of sliding windows usually follows a methodical approach. While the specific approaches can vary, the procedure detailed below acts as a general standard.
Step 1: Measure the Opening
Precise measurements are vital. Utilizing the tape measure, determine the width and height of the existing [Historic Window Restoration](https://schoolido.lu/user/pastrysled1/) frame. Deduct 1/4 inch from each measurement to represent expansion and fit.
Step 2: Prepare the OpeningRemove Old Window: Carefully take off the old window and tidy the opening. Examine for Damage: Check for rot or damage around the frame and change any jeopardized wood.Step 3: Install the Sill
The sill serves as the base for your sliding window. Set up a water resistant flashing tape to the bottom of the opening to ensure it stays devoid of water damage.
Step 4: Set the Window FramePosition the Frame: Place the sliding [Sash Window Design](http://soumoli.com/home.php?mod=space&uid=825627) frame into the opening. Look for Level: Use a level to make sure that the window is straight. Adjust accordingly by adding shims if essential.Step 5: Secure the Frame
Using screws, secure the window frame to the sides of the opening. Ensure to follow the maker's guidelines for screw positioning.
Step 6: Install the Sashes
Slide the sashes into the tracks offered in the frame. Ensure they move smoothly which the locking system works appropriately.
Action 7: Weatherproofing
Apply insulation foam around the perimeter to improve energy efficiency. Seal the edges with a water resistant sealant to avoid air leaks.
Step 8: Finishing Touches
Finally, include interior and exterior trim as needed to hide gaps. Paint or stain the trim to match the existing design.

Q: How long does it require to set up a sliding window?A: Depending on your experience level, installing a sliding window can take anywhere from 2 to 5 hours. Q: Can I install sliding [Victorian Sash Windows](https://mlx.su/paste/view/8e20ad54) in winter?A: Yes, but bemindful that cold temperatures can affect materials
like sealant. Ensure you pick the right products for your environment. Q: What is the typical expense of sliding [Period Window Restoration](https://chessdatabase.science/wiki/How_Can_A_Weekly_Sliding_Window_Installation_Project_Can_Change_Your_Life) installation?A: The cost can differ commonly based on window size and quality, but generally, you can expect to pay in between ₤ 300 to ₤ 1,000 per window, including labor. Q: How do I understand if my windows need replacing?A: Signs include drafts, condensation in between panes, difficulty opening or closing, and rotting frames.

Q: Do sliding windows supply good insulation?A: Yes
, supplied they are set up properly and are of high quality, sliding windows can offer great insulation.
